java快速书写代码 java如何编写代码

java写一个自动程序开始先怎么写使用Eclipse编写自己的第一个Java代码 。
编写如下:
1、首先打开自己安装的Eclipse软件 。
2、然后选择File-New-JavaProject 。
3、然后找到工程打开,右击src选择-New-Class 。
4、填入类名,选择下面的publicstaticvoidmain(String[]args) 。
5、然后写入代码publicclassDemo{publicstaticvoidmain(String[]args){//TODOAuto-generatedmethodstubSystem.out.println(HelloWorld) 。
【java快速书写代码 java如何编写代码】6、点击上面的运行按钮,点击确认 , 可以看到代码运行结果 。
能快速提高java的代码好代码都是不断重构和调整来的,多动手,多实践 , 多看看重构、设计模式、代码之美、代码之丑等 。
如果刚入手,有几点建议:
1 不要重复代码:发现有功能重复就试着重构出单独的方法;
2 不要开发你目前用不到的功能:
3 用最简单的方法让程序跑起来:只有可以运行的代码才有优化的意义;
4 抽离不变性等:
5 写测试用例,重构才有保障 。
面向对象的几大设计原则 , 慢慢体会:
开闭原则;
单一职责原则;
合成复用原则;
迪米特法则等;
北大青鸟java培训:系统程序员怎样把代码写得又快又好?很多初学者包括一些有经验的程序员,在敲完代码的最后一个字符后,马上开始编译和运行,迫不急待的想看到自己的工作成果 。
快速反馈有助于满足自己的成就感,但是同时也会带来一些问题:让编译器帮你检查语法错误可以省些时间,但程序员往往太专注这些错误了,以为改完这些错误就万事大吉了 。
其实不然,很多错误编译器是发现不了的,像内存错误和线程死锁等等,这些错误可能逃过简单的测试而遗留在代码中,直到集成测试或者软件发布之后才暴露出来 , 那时就要花更大代价去修改它们了 。
修改完编译错误之后就是运行程序了,运行起来有错误 , 就轮到调试器上场了 。
花了不少时间去调试,发现无非是些低级错误,或许你会自责自己粗心大意,但是下次可能还是犯同样的错误 。
更严重的是这种debugfix的方法,往往是头痛医头脚痛医脚,导致低质量的软件 。
让编译器帮你检查语法错误,让调试器帮你查BUG , 这是天经地义的事,但这确实是又慢又烂的方法 。
就像你要到离家东边1000米的地方开会,结果你往西边走,又是坐车又是搭飞机,花了一周时间,也绕着地球转了一周,终于到了会议室,你还大发感慨说,现代的交通工具真是发达啊 。
其实你往东走 , 走路也只要十多分钟就到了 。
不管你的调试技巧有多高,都不如一次性写好更高效 。
下面是我在阅读自己代码时的一些方法:检查常见错误第一遍阅读时主要关注语法错误、代码排版和命名规则等等问题,只要看不顺眼就修改它们 。
读完之后,你的代码很少有低级错误 , 看起来也比较干净清爽 。
第二遍重点关注常见编程错误,比如内存泄露和可能的越界访问,变量没有初始化 , 函数忘记返回值等等,在后面的章节中,我会介绍这些常见错误,避免这些错误可以为你省大量的时间 。
如果有时间,在测试完成之后,还可以考虑是否有更好的实现方法,甚至尝试重新去实现它们 。
说了读者可能不相信,在学习编程的前几年,我经常重写整个模块,只我觉得能做得更好,能验证我的一些想法 , 或提高我的编程能力 , 即使连续几天加班到晚上十一点,我也要重写它们 。

推荐阅读